Kernel for computing elementwise hyperbolic arc-sine of an input vector. Supports float datatype.
|
| template<typename T > |
| MATHLIB_STATUS | MATHLIB_asinh (size_t length, T *pSrc, T *pDst) |
| | Performs the elementwise hyperbolic arc-sine of an input vector. Function can be overloaded with float pointers, and the appropriate precision is employed to compute elementwise hyperbolic arc-sine of a vector. More...
|
| |
| MATHLIB_STATUS | MATHLIB_asinh_sp (size_t length, float *pSrc, float *pDst) |
| | This function is the C interface for MATHLIB_asinh. Function accepts float pointers. More...
|
| |
◆ MATHLIB_asinh()
Performs the elementwise hyperbolic arc-sine of an input vector. Function can be overloaded with float pointers, and the appropriate precision is employed to compute elementwise hyperbolic arc-sine of a vector.
- Template Parameters
-
| T | : implementation datatype |
- Parameters
-
| [in] | length | : length of input vector |
| [in] | pSrc | : pointer to buffer holding input vector |
| [out] | pDst | : pointer to buffer holding result vector |
- Returns
- Status of success
◆ MATHLIB_asinh_sp()
| MATHLIB_STATUS MATHLIB_asinh_sp |
( |
size_t |
length, |
|
|
float * |
pSrc, |
|
|
float * |
pDst |
|
) |
| |
This function is the C interface for MATHLIB_asinh. Function accepts float pointers.
- Template Parameters
-
| T | : implementation datatype |
- Parameters
-
| [in] | length | : length of input vector |
| [in] | pSrc | : pointer to buffer holding input vector |
| [out] | pDst | : pointer to buffer holding result vector |
- Returns
- Status of success
Definition at line 481 of file MATHLIB_asinh.cpp.